Abstract

The port-Hamiltonian formalism is a very powerful tool for describing dynamical systems and their interconnections and for designing control laws with specified energetic properties. In this paper, in particular, it is shown how a variable structure control can be designed in this general framework in order to achieve a passive systems with, additionally, the robust properties obtainable with variable structure systems. Simulation results obtained with a 2-dof manipulator are reported and discussed in order to validate the proposed approach.
